Health Insurance Explained – The YouToons Have It Covered
Millions of us now have health insurance below the Affordable Care Act, or what some people call Obamacare. But once many things in life, your health insurance can often be uncertain and complicated. Whether you've been insured for years or you're other to the game, harmony your policy is important to your health and your wallet. First things first, you have to pay your premium every month or your insurance could acquire cancelled - nice of subsequent to your cable subscription. You can plus think of it following a shared health care piggy bank -- we all chip in each month, even if we're healthy, for that reason the child maintenance is there in imitation of we infatuation it. If you get insurance at work, your employer probably pays most of your premium and the land comes out of your paycheck automatically. If you have Medicaid, you most likely don't have to pay any premium at all -- the federal processing and your come clean admit care of that.
If you're insured through a additional health insurance marketplace, depending on your income, you may be eligible for a tax tally that pays a allowance of your premium. past you have that shining extra insurance card, you'll want to attempt really difficult to save it in your wallet! To bigger your odds at staying healthy, be positive to believe advantage of the pardon preventive facilities that all extra insurance plans provide. But of course...stuff happens. And that's taking into consideration insurance in fact comes in handy. Now, having insurance helps a lot, but it doesn't ambition every your health care is going to be free. There are lots of details nearly your insurance plan that be in how much you pay following you get sick or injured.
If you have Medicaid, a lot of these facilities could entirely with ease be free. Otherwise, you'll likely have to pay something as soon as you go to the doctor or occupy a prescription. This is called a copay like it's a specific dollar amount -- in the manner of $25 per visit... or coinsurance if it's a percentage of the bill. There's plus the deductible -- that's how much comes out of your own pocket past your insurance starts paying. Depending on your plan, you might have a deductible for all your care, or it might unaided apply to some types of care, past hospital stays and prescriptions.
So approach your plan material, because it can direct into the thousands of dollars! unconventional important part of your plan is the out of pocket maximum.
This is the most you'll ever have to pay in any one year. At least for the relieve your plot covers. Your insurer will pay 100% of all on top of the maximum for the flaming of the year. It can be just as vague dealing in the same way as prescriptions! Your scheme has a list of drugs it will pay for, called a formulary, but the prices vary.
Check in imitation of your doctor or pharmacist, because a generic drug might fix you stirring the thesame as a brand herald drug, but the price difference could be huge. So, those are the costs typically involved, but remember that they'll be affected by your insurance plan's provider network. This is a list of doctors and hospitals that are associated to your plan.
Insurance companies negotiate discounts in the manner of these providers. Stay in-network, and the discounts acquire passed to you. o out of network, and you could end stirring paying full price. And recall that out-of-pocket limit? It won't produce an effect if you go out of network! In some plans -- with HMOs or EPOs -- your insurance would pay nothing if you go out-of-network. In further plans -- following PPOs -- your insurance will lid you no concern where you go, but you'll pay a lot more if you go out of network.
Also, if you desire to visit a specialist - considering an orthopedist - some plans require a referral from your primary care doctor. solid simple enough? Well, sometimes staying in-network can be tricky! In a hospital, it's realistic that your surgeon could be in-network, though your anesthesiologist is not. Don't be afraid to negotiate similar to your provider or file an charisma once your insurer. consequently as you can see, there's a lot to think very nearly next you choose an insurance plot each year. Some plans may have low premiums, but fewer doctors or hospitals and high deductibles. There are tradeoffs, and bargain and choosing accompanied by plans isn't always easy. Remember, if you have questions call your health plot and ask, or check considering your hospital or doctor. If you still have questions, your confess insurance department or Consumer guidance Program can help. later the Affordable Care Act, there's extra withhold for consumers, therefore say you will advantage of it! Having health insurance sponsorship is a fine thing, especially gone you know how it works. We hope you're now bigger prepared for the next time you have to pull that health insurance card out of your wallet.
